Interactive Model (3D Map)

This tool is designed to provide a look at the significant private and public investment taking place in Cleveland’s Central Business District, Midtown, University Circle and portions of Hough, Glenville and Fairfax neighborhoods.

The model allows users to virtually navigate downtown and identify projects in various stages of investment and development, highlighting the opportunities shaping the city’s growth for the next decade.

Project Status Category Definitions

  • Existing: Projects that have been opened/completed for 5+ years 
  • Recently Completed: Projects that have been opened/completed less than 5 years
  • Under Construction: Project that has completed funding/financing and/or is under construction
  • Planned: Project has received City Planning Commission approval but is not fully funded/financed
  • Concept/Study: Project/initiative is publicly announced but in exploratory/due diligence phase
  • Development Opportunities: Property is available or being actively marketed for development

Model - Latest Updates

Updated in July 2023, it includes major downtown developments, as well as major institutions such as the Cleveland Clinic and Case Western Reserve University, including the proposed Innovation District. Additions in July added 169 buildings to the initial 198, and almost four- square miles, nearly doubling its scope (original model was 4.77 square miles).

The model represents over $1.8B in investment underway or planned. It will continue to be updated as investments progress through phases of development and as new projects and plans are initiated.

This model is intended to serve as a resource to policymakers, real estate developers and investors, public officials, community leaders, and the general public by highlighting major projects, plans, and opportunities that will continue to shape Downtown Cleveland’s growth for the next decade.

The Downtown Cleveland Digital Model was designed and built by Cleveland-based City Architecture and is managed by Greater Cleveland Partnership in collaboration with the City of ClevelandDowntown Cleveland AllianceOhio City IncorporatedCampus District and Flats Forward.
